Siquijor Island: A Mystical Retreat Amidst Nature

Renowned as the “Island of Fire,” Siquijor captivates visitors with its mystical glow, courtesy of the myriad fireflies nestled in molave trees. This enchanting island is not just about folklore; it’s a paradise of natural wonders. Siquijor tourist spots like the magical Cambugahay Falls, with its turquoise waters and serene ambiance, offer a glimpse into a fairy-tale world. The ancient Balete Tree, coupled with a natural fish spa, presents a unique eco-tourism experience, making Siquijor a top destination for Philippines travel enthusiasts.

Apo Island: A Haven for Marine Life Conservation

Apo Island, a beacon of successful marine conservation, is a volcanic wonderland both above and below the water. Its marine reserve, established in the 1980s, is a testament to the vibrant coral reefs and diverse marine life thriving around the island. Swimming with sea turtles here offers an intimate encounter with nature, reinforcing the island’s appeal as a premier Philippine diving destination. The warm hospitality of the local community further enhances the charm of Apo Island, making it a peaceful retreat for nature lovers.

Batanes: The Northern Beauty of Rugged Landscapes

Batanes sets itself apart with its dramatic landscapes that bear a striking resemblance to the picturesque hills of New Zealand rather than the tropical paradises associated with the Philippines. The traditional Ivatan houses and the integrity of the honesty shops reflect a culture deeply intertwined with nature. Batanes’ rolling hills and stunning cliffs offer some of the best scenic views in the Philippines, appealing to adventure seekers and those pursuing tranquility alike.

Tablas Island: A Diver’s Paradise Untouched

Tablas, the largest of the Romblon islands, is a sanctuary of hidden coves, unspoiled beaches, and serene landscapes. Its underwater world, featuring sites like the Blue Hole, is a spectacle of biodiversity, attracting diving enthusiasts from around the globe. Beaches such as Aglicay and Binucot are perfect for relaxing getaways, offering secluded spots for enjoying nature’s beauty in peace.

Danjugan Island: The Pinnacle of Eco-Tourism

Danjugan Island epitomizes eco-tourism, with its commitment to conservation and sustainable travel. Its rich ecosystems, from the vibrant coral reefs to the lush mangroves, showcase the ecological diversity of the Philippines. Eco-friendly activities like snorkeling, kayaking, and bird watching not only offer immersive experiences but also support conservation efforts, making Danjugan a model for responsible tourism.
